Output d121b5dc4e63c626ba10fb752de215c29bb8150cebcdefcace1a27c5e553da28:8

value
847660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1d77dd1fa305e5c7b59166c062b94553b67890 OP_EQUAL
address
MHfXqSguHbAeiwR4d9W6rhbawxiX71TRgc
transaction
d121b5dc4e63c626ba10fb752de215c29bb8150cebcdefcace1a27c5e553da28
spent
true